Niall Toner interviews Bela Fleck

Naill Toner and Bela FleckIrish bluegrass affeniato Niall Toner, mandolin and guitar player with the Niall Toner Band, interviewed Bela Fleck during a recent trip the banjo player took to Ireland. The interview is set to be broadcast on RTE Radio 1, on which Niall regularly hosts a show.

The show containing this interview will be broadcast on May 3rd at 9 PM. I’m assuming that is local time in Ireland which is five hours ahead of EST in the US so that would place the show time at 4PM EST. I’m told the show will be available for online listening.

What did Niall and Bela talk about in the interview?

all aspects of the 5-string banjo, including his ventures into jazz, blues, and classical music, as well as his ongoing contribution to bluegrass.

This particular program is not part of Naill’s normal weekly show, but instead is a special. The first of many he hopes to broadcast.
